Farrah Farnese Roma is a director at JFF. She specializes in developing systems and programs that promote pathways to high-quality careers for youth and young adults.

Her expertise lies in:

  • Creating accessible and equitable continuums of opportunities that allow youth and young adults to explore and experience the world of work and gain meaningful skills that support entry and advancement in a career track.
  • She has a proven track record in developing a shared vision and collaboration across stakeholders to address common programmatic barriers to impact change.
  • Over the past 15 years, she has developed, delivered, and evaluated quality work-based learning programs at scale.

Prior to joining JFF, Farrah was vice president for programs at the Philadelphia Youth Network. In that role, she oversaw an annual programmatic budget of $15M and a portfolio of over 100 diverse programs via 80+ sub-contracted provider organizations delivering school-year, summer, and year-round programming to over 8K youth and young adults in Philadelphia annually.

Farrah holds a bachelor’s degree in public relations from Pennsylvania State University.
